Woktastic, Birmingham

 Woktastic = WOW!

I absolutely love Japanese/Asian Fusion style food and Woktastic is doing it at it's best! It takes elements from two of my favourite chain restaurants Wagamama and Yo Sushi! then puts them together under one roof!


I didn't quite know what to expect when I heard that I was going eat at Woktastic with RB, his sister and brother-in-law. It was one of their favourites but the name conjured up the idea of bad Chinese buffet restaurants. I was pleasantly surprised when I was the beautiful bright decor and a sushi conveyor belt. My pictures are pretty poor... I'm sorry for this! We had been to the gym so were really hungry and also the food/conversation were so good, I nearly forgot to take photos at all!

We really over did it with the starters! We had a starter each, mine being the Agedashi Tofu with Sweet Chili Dip, which was sublime! Every time I have tried to tempura silken tofu it always goes wrong, but it is one of my most favourite things to eat! As RB and I were very hungry we took advantage of the unlimited Miso Soup and some of the veggie sushi they had to offer, the sushi pictured is Mooli Maki, but we also had Inari Nigiri. We washed it down with Plum Wine, which was so yummy and I don't know why I hadn't had it before!

There were a fair few vegetarian main courses to choose from, but I settled from Tempura Vegetables which came served with curry sauce, sticky rice and salad. This photo doesn't look amazing as there is a bit too much curry sauce, but it is better than there being too little! It tasted great though and even when I was completely full and about to burst I couldn't stop eating it!

Woktastic is great! It has loads of vegetarian options, both on its main menu and sushi menu. Everything on the menu is also clearly labelled to show it is vegetarian. It is definitely worth going to if you're ever visiting Birmingham!
